MIAMI – Heat star Dwyane Wade tweeted his displeasure with the NBA league office on Tuesday night.
The NBA fined Oklahoma City's Serge Ibaka $25,000 for hitting Blake Griffin in the groin on Sunday.

Back in December, Wade received a heavier fine and was suspended one game for a shot to the groin area on Charlotte's Ramon Sessions.
Wade tweeted Tuesday night, "All I can say is WoW... no pun intended but really... and I get suspended and lose 200 grand... #someexplainingtodo."
LeBron James also tweeted about Ibaka's punishment.
James wrote, "So explain to me the difference? My teammate gets a 1 game suspension and 150K+ taking him away from him for his groin altercation #strangetome."
